PIA Opens Cabin Crew Jobs in Islamabad and Lahore

PIA Opens Cabin Crew Jobs in Islamabad and Lahore
IslamabadAirline Jobs

Quick Answer

Pakistan International Airlines has opened cabin crew jobs for male and female candidates in Islamabad and Lahore. Applicants must be between 20 and 28 years old, hold at least a bachelor’s degree and meet PIA’s language, height, medical and grooming requirements. The last date to apply online is August 31, 2026.

Pakistan International Airlines (PIA) has invited applications for new cabin crew positions as the national airline prepares to expand its operations.

The newly recruited crew members are expected to work on PIA flights from its Islamabad and Lahore bases. Reports have linked the recruitment drive with the airline’s plans for new aircraft and routes, but PIA has not disclosed the number or types of aircraft connected with these jobs.

Both male and female candidates who meet the required qualifications can apply. Applications must be submitted through the official online channel before the closing date.

Education and Age Requirements

Applicants must be between 20 and 28 years old when they submit their application. PIA has not mentioned any age relaxation in the recruitment details.

Candidates must hold a bachelor’s degree or a higher qualification from a recognised institution. The advertisement does not limit eligibility to a particular academic subject, which means graduates from different educational backgrounds may apply if they meet the other conditions.

Is Previous Cabin Crew Experience Required?

Previous work experience is not compulsory for these positions. Fresh candidates with the required education and skills may also submit an application.

However, experience in an airline, hotel, hospitality company or another customer-service industry will be considered an advantage. Candidates who already hold valid flying or cabin crew authorisation will receive preference during shortlisting.

This preference does not automatically guarantee selection because applicants must still meet the airline’s medical, communication and professional standards.

Language and Communication Skills

Fluency in spoken and written English is required. Knowledge of additional languages may strengthen an application, especially because cabin crew members regularly serve passengers from different countries.

PIA is looking for candidates who can communicate clearly, remain polite in difficult situations and work effectively with other crew members. A service-focused attitude and the ability to stay calm under pressure are also important parts of the role.

Height and Medical Standards

The minimum height requirement is 160 centimetres for female applicants and 168 centimetres for male applicants.

Candidates must also meet the aviation medical standards required by the airline. These include colour-vision screening because cabin crew members must recognise safety signs, warning lights and emergency equipment during flights.

Meeting the education and age criteria alone will not be enough if an applicant does not pass the required medical assessment.

Grooming and Character Requirements

Cabin crew members represent the airline while dealing directly with passengers. PIA therefore requires professional grooming, appropriate presentation and a neat appearance.

Applicants should not have tattoos or piercings that remain visible while wearing the official cabin crew uniform. A clear character record is also required, and candidates may undergo background verification before final selection.

Main Responsibilities of Cabin Crew

Cabin crew work involves passenger safety as well as in-flight service. Successful candidates may be responsible for:

  • Completing safety checks before departure

  • Demonstrating emergency procedures

  • Helping passengers during boarding and disembarkation

  • Responding to passenger requests

  • Supporting elderly passengers, children and people requiring assistance

  • Coordinating with pilots and other crew members

  • Handling difficult situations professionally

  • Following PIA’s safety, conduct and grooming rules

  • Providing courteous in-flight service

Candidates should understand that the role requires irregular working hours, teamwork and the ability to perform duties under pressure.

How to Apply for PIA Cabin Crew Jobs

Eligible candidates must submit their applications online through the official PIA recruitment channel. The application page can also be accessed by scanning the QR code included in the recruitment advertisement.

Applicants need to upload:

  • An updated CV

  • A recent photograph

  • Correct personal information

  • Educational and contact details

Candidates should review all information before submitting the form. PIA has not announced an offline application method, so applications should only be submitted through the official online channel.

Expected Recruitment Process

Applications will first be reviewed to identify candidates who meet the basic conditions. Shortlisted applicants may then be called for screening, assessment and medical evaluation.

Character verification may also be completed before final appointments. Only shortlisted candidates are expected to receive further communication regarding the selection process.

Applicants should rely on messages sent through official PIA channels and avoid paying money to unauthorised individuals who claim they can guarantee selection.

Salary and Employment Benefits

The advertisement refers to employment rewards, travel privileges, health and welfare benefits, training and opportunities for career development.

However, the exact salary, contract period and complete benefits package have not been made public. These details may be shared with shortlisted or selected applicants during the recruitment process.

Important Information Not Yet Announced

PIA has not disclosed the total number of available positions. It has also not confirmed the joining date, training schedule, salary range or exact distribution of vacancies between Islamabad and Lahore.

The airline has been reported to be recruiting staff ahead of operational expansion, but detailed information about the aircraft and routes assigned to the new crew has not been officially provided. These points should remain unconfirmed until PIA issues further details.
